I can't use my mobile phone as a Wi-Fi Hotspot
This troubleshooting guide will take you through a number of possible causes
to help you find a solution to your problem.
Set up your mobile phone as a Wi-Fi Hotspot.
1. Tap Settings.
2. Tap Cellular.
3. Tap Personal Hotspot.
4. Tap the indicator next to "Personal Hotspot" until the function is turned on.
5. If you're asked to turn on Wi-Fi and Bluetooth:Tap Turn on Wi-Fi and Bluetooth.
6. Tap Wi-Fi Password.
7. Key in the required password and tap Done.

8. Do the following on the device which is to connect to your personal Hotspot:Turn on Wi-Fi.Find the list of available Wi-Fi networks.Select your mobile phone on the list.Key in the password you selected in step 3 and establish a connection to your mobile phone.When the connection is established, you can access the internet from the other device.
